
Children's Halloween Extravaganza at Colby
Colby College will hold its second annual Children's Halloween Extravaganza on Sunday, October 31, from 3 to 6 p.m. The event is free of charge and open to all community children age two to 10 years old. Activities, which begin at the Pugh Center, Cotter Union, will include trick-or-treating, haunted houses, pumpkin decorating, face painting and more. Holiday refreshments will be served.
The event is organized by the Colby Volunteer Center and Student Government Association as a fun and safe alternative to trick-or-treating on the streets. All children must be accompanied by an adult. The Halloween activities will be held in the Pugh Center and designated spots in the residence halls.
